Factors to Consider When Choosing Smart Water Leak Detectors

When selecting a smart water leak detector, I consider factors like how well it connects to my existing systems and how loud its alarms are. I also look at its detection range, sensitivity, and battery life to guarantee reliable protection with minimal maintenance. Finally, ease of installation and user-friendliness are key to making sure I get the most out of my device.
Connectivity Compatibility
Are you confident that your smart water leak detector will seamlessly integrate with your existing home setup? Compatibility is key to ensuring smooth operation. First, check if the device supports your Wi-Fi network’s bands—most work with 2.4 GHz, but some also support 5 GHz. Determine whether it connects directly to Wi-Fi or needs a hub or base station, as this impacts setup and reliability. Be aware of specific wireless protocols like Sub-1G, LoRa, or TUYA, which can influence range and integration with other smart devices. Also, verify that the app and alert systems are compatible with your smartphone’s operating system—iOS or Android—for easy notifications. Finally, consider if it supports voice assistants like Alexa or Google Assistant for hands-free control.
Alarm Volume & Alerts
Choosing a smart water leak detector with the right alarm volume is essential to guarantee you’re promptly alerted to leaks, regardless of your home’s noise levels or sleeping habits. Many models offer adjustable alarm volumes up to 120dB, ensuring they can be heard across different rooms or floors. Some detectors also provide multiple alert methods, like app notifications, SMS, or emails, giving you flexible options for leak response. Volume settings are often customizable, allowing quieter alerts at night or in noisy environments, and louder alarms for high-traffic areas. The effectiveness of alerts depends on both volume and sound quality; louder alarms are better at waking sleepers or cutting through noise. Many models include silent or mute options, so you can disable sounds when needed without losing leak notifications.
Detection Range & Sensitivity
A smart water leak detector’s effectiveness hinges on its detection range and sensitivity, which determine how well it can identify leaks early and accurately. A longer detection range allows sensors to cover larger areas, increasing the chance of catching leaks before water damage occurs. Sensitivity levels are essential; higher sensitivity lets the sensor detect even minor leaks or pooling water. Some detectors feature dual probes or multiple sensing points, improving detection from different directions and boosting accuracy. The communication technology impacts range: Wi-Fi sensors typically cover 150-328 feet, while LoRa can reach up to a quarter mile. However, higher sensitivity sensors might produce false alarms in humid environments, so finding a balance based on your home’s conditions is key.
Battery Life & Maintenance
When selecting a smart water leak detector, battery life is a critical factor because it directly affects how often you’ll need to perform maintenance or replacements. Longer battery life means fewer interruptions and less hassle, with some detectors lasting up to five years on a single set of batteries. Devices with replaceable batteries require periodic checks and timely replacements to keep them functioning properly. Thankfully, many models offer battery status notifications via apps or alerts, helping me stay ahead of potential failures. Battery-powered detectors also simplify installation since they eliminate wiring, reducing long-term upkeep. Choosing high-quality batteries, like alkaline AAA, can substantially improve lifespan and reliability. Overall, prioritizing battery life ensures continuous protection without frequent maintenance, giving me peace of mind.

How Do Smart Leak Detectors Integrate With Existing Home Security Systems?
Smart leak detectors typically integrate with existing home security systems through Wi-Fi or Zigbee/Z-Wave protocols. I connect them to my hub or smart home app, allowing seamless alerts and automation. When a leak is detected, I get instant notifications on my phone, and I can even trigger other devices like shut-off valves or alarms. This integration provides peace of mind and central control over my home’s safety.
